A running course around the Imperial Palace, which is circular about five kilometers , is very popular. Until the end of 2014, I was a company's employee for 35 years. During this period, as the office was close to the course, I've ever run the course two or three times. The course has good points for runners. It doesn't have any traffic signal, so they run nonstop. In addition, they have a nice view. If you stay in the middle of Tokyo, running the course might be your good memory.
